Valprovia Teams Center Release Notes
Release v2.26.12
(25.08.2025)
Introduction
This focused release strengthens data integrity and user experience by implementing comprehensive validation rules for Document Set configurations. We've established clear guardrails to prevent configuration errors and ensure SharePoint compatibility across all workspace deployments.
Enhancements
๐ ๏ธ Enhanced Document Set Field Validation:
Implemented robust validation rules for Document Set internal names and display names to ensure SharePoint compatibility and prevent provisioning failures. The internal name field now enforces strict character restrictions, prohibiting special characters (" # % * : < > ? / \ |
) and periods at the beginning or end of values, while both fields respect the 255-character limit. Display names have been liberalized to accept all special characters while maintaining length constraints. These enhancements provide immediate user feedback with clear, actionable error messages, preventing downstream provisioning issues and ensuring seamless Document Set deployment across all Teams workspaces.
------------------------------------------------------------
Release v2.26.11
(08.08.2025)
Introduction
This patch release addresses workflow integrity issues affecting bulk operations, notification systems, and identity management. We've prioritized fixing edge cases that impact day-to-day administrative operations and team collaboration scenarios.
Enhancements
๐ ๏ธ OneNote Tab Naming Consistency:
Resolved an issue where custom-named OneNote tabs were unexpectedly reverting to default "Notes" naming during bulk template updates. This fix ensures that administrators' intentional naming choices are preserved across template versioning and bulk operations, maintaining consistency in workspace configurations and preventing confusion for end users navigating channel resources.
๐ ๏ธ Nested Group Membership Optimization:
Corrected the provisioning behavior for nested group members to prevent redundant individual user additions. The system now properly recognizes nested group hierarchies, eliminating duplicate membership requests and reducing synchronization overhead while maintaining accurate group-based access control.
๐ ๏ธ Channel Guest Notification Enhancement:
Fixed a Logic App workflow issue that was generating empty notification emails when multiple users were added as channel guests simultaneously. The improved logic ensures that all notification emails contain appropriate content, enhancing communication reliability and providing recipients with meaningful invitation details.
๐ ๏ธ Guest Approval Workflow Restoration:
Resolved a identity resolution issue where new guest approval requests were failing due to uninitialized user IDs. The fix ensures workspace owners receive proper approval notifications for guest invitations, restoring the complete approval workflow and maintaining security governance for external collaboration.
------------------------------------------------------------
Release v2.26.10
(05.08.2025)
Introduction
This quality-focused release enhances Teams Center's cross-tenant collaboration capabilities and search functionality. We've refined error handling, request processing accuracy, and data type compatibility to deliver a more robust and intuitive user experience.
Enhancements
๐ ๏ธ Improved Trusted-Tenant User Search Experience:
Refined error handling for shared channel guest searches to provide graceful degradation when querying non-trusted tenant users. This enhancement replaces internal server errors with appropriate user feedback, ensuring administrators receive clear guidance when searching across tenant boundaries and improving the overall shared channel management experience.
๐ ๏ธ Private Channel Member Removal Accuracy:
Corrected the request status reporting mechanism for internal guest removal from private channels. While the removal operation was executing successfully, the system now accurately reflects completion status, eliminating false failure notifications and providing administrators with reliable confirmation of membership changes.
๐ ๏ธ Enhanced Internal Guest Search Compatibility:
Resolved a critical data type mismatch in the Microsoft Graph API filter clause that prevented successful searches for internal guests. The fix ensures proper handling of boolean values in string extension attributes, restoring full search functionality and enabling administrators to efficiently locate and manage internal guest users across the platform.
------------------------------------------------------------
Release v2.26.9
(11.07.2025)
Introduction
This focused release addresses a collaboration feature to ensure seamless integration between Teams and OneNote. We've prioritized restoring full functionality to enhance the day-to-day productivity experience for all users.
Enhancements
๐ ๏ธ OneNote Tab Integration Restoration:
Resolved a provisioning issue that prevented OneNote tabs from loading correctly within the Teams client interface. This fix ensures that custom-named OneNote tabs, particularly those renamed from the default configuration, now open reliably within Teams channels. While OneNote notebooks remained accessible through SharePoint and direct links, this enhancement restores the native in-Teams experience, eliminating workflow disruptions and ensuring consistent cross-platform collaboration capabilities.
------------------------------------------------------------
Release v2.26.8
(03.06.2025
Introduction
This release strengthens Teams Center's compliance capabilities and lifecycle management precision. We've restored security features and refined expiration handling to ensure consistent governance across all workspace scenarios.
New Features
๐ Restored Sensitivity Labels Provisioning:
Successfully re-engineered our Sensitivity Labels provisioning capability to align with Microsoft's latest CSOM architecture changes. This restoration ensures organizations can maintain their information protection strategies seamlessly, enabling comprehensive data classification and protection policies across all Teams workspaces. The updated implementation guarantees full compatibility with current Microsoft security frameworks while preserving existing label configurations.
Enhancements
๐ ๏ธ Stabilized Group Expiration Persistence: Enhanced the expiration date management logic to preserve group lifecycle settings when workspace membership changes occur. This improvement ensures that groups with unlimited expiration maintain their intended lifecycle configuration, preventing unintended policy modifications during routine membership operations and maintaining governance consistency.
------------------------------------------------------------
Release v2.26.7
(15.05.2025)
Introduction
This strategic release expands Teams Center's enterprise capabilities by significantly enhancing template scalability. We've reimagined the architectural limits to support complex organizational structures and sophisticated governance scenarios at scale.
New Features
๐ Enterprise-Scale Template Visibility Management:
Dramatically increased the supported limit for user and security group visibility configurations within templates, elevating from 15 to support 40+ groups. This enhancement empowers organizations to implement more granular and comprehensive access control strategies while maintaining optimal system performance. The improved architecture eliminates previous Graph API query limitations and ensures robust database performance even under complex visibility configurations, enabling true enterprise-grade template governance at scale.
------------------------------------------------------------
Release v2.26.6
(12.05.2025)
Introduction
This maintenance release delivers essential stability improvements to enhance the Teams Center experience. We've focused on streamlining critical workflows and ensuring seamless platform upgrades to maintain operational excellence across all deployment scenarios.
๐ ๏ธ Enhanced Join Request Processing:
Optimized the membership synchronization workflow to ensure robust handling of join requests across all team lifecycle states. This improvement addresses edge cases in the synchronization pipeline, delivering more reliable membership management even during complex archiving scenarios.
------------------------------------------------------------
Release v2.26.5
(28.04.2025)
Introduction
This patch release addresses bug fixes improving group handling, guest management UX, governance error display, validation flows, channel expiration synchronization, UI alignment, crash resilience, and request reliability across the Teams provisioning experience .
๐ ๏ธ Guest Display Name Edit:
Invited guest's display name cannot be changed while adding.
๐ ๏ธ Governance Error Visibility:
Governance error is not visible if maximum member count is reached.
๐ ๏ธ Back Button Disable During Validation:
Disable back button while a group is "validating".
๐ ๏ธ Concurrent Group Validation:
If more than 1 group added and validating finishes simultaneously then the send request/next button is disabled in members/guests.
๐ ๏ธ Stuck Group Removal:
If more than one group is removed in guests, one is removed but the others get stuck in validating process.
๐ ๏ธ Private Channel Expiration Sync:
If a user's expiration date is updated in workspace it is now also updated in private channels.
๐ ๏ธ Nested Group Expiration Calculation:
If workspace has a nested group then the user expiration date is calculated correctly in private channels.
๐ ๏ธ Team Settings Option Rename:
Rename "Allow members to create, update and remove apps" option in team settings.
๐ ๏ธ Group Limit Manageability:
Fixed issue where workspaces with more than 15 groups became unmanageable.
๐ ๏ธ Guest Request Failure:
Fixed failure of guest requests for a specific workspace.
๐ ๏ธ Multiple Guest Invite Fix:
When inviting multiple guests only one was addedโnow all invited guests are added correctly.
------------------------------------------------------------
Release v2.26.4
(08.04.2025)
Introduction
This maintenance release enhances UI stability by fixing crash scenarios related to governance rules and editing operations. These fixes improve the reliability of workspace configuration workflows.
๐ ๏ธ Minimum Members Governance:
Fixed a crash that occurred when a minimum members governance rule was applied, preventing the page from loading properly.
๐ ๏ธ Minimum Members Governance:
Resolved an error causing the page to crash when editing template metadata.
๐ ๏ธ Logo Edit:
Addressed a crash triggered by editing or updating the workspace logo.
------------------------------------------------------------
Release v2.26.3
(02.04.2025)
Introduction
This patch release delivers fixes to improve group visibility for guests.
๐ ๏ธ Group Visibility in Guests:
Fixed an issue where certain groups were not appearing in the guest list, ensuring all invited groups are now correctly displayed.
------------------------------------------------------------
Release v2.26.2
(20.03.2025)
Introduction
This patch release resolves a variety of edge-case bugs around archiving fallback logic, character support in group emails and site URLs, and the provisioning and cleanup of shared and private channel memberships. These fixes enhance reliability when applying template updates and managing guest and group access.
๐ ๏ธ Archiving Fallback Enforcement:
If a workspace lacked SharePoint archiving settings but the updated template defined them, the workspace now correctly applies the โfallbackโ value after a bulk update.
๐ ๏ธ Group Email Character Support:
Special characters are now properly allowed in generated group email addresses to prevent provisioning errors.
๐ ๏ธ Site URL Character Support:
Special characters in site URLs are now accepted without causing validation failures.
๐ ๏ธ Shared Channel Guest Removal:
Fixed a case where shared channel guests were never removed due to missing removal requests.
๐ ๏ธ Channel Membership Provisioning:
Resolved an issue preventing group users from being added to private or shared channels during creation.
------------------------------------------------------------
Release v2.26.1
(11.03.2025)
Introduction
This patch release delivers critical bug fixes addressing issues in channel filtering, trial environment requests, guest and group expiration cleanup, archive processes, and template management to improve stability and ensure consistent behavior across workspaces.
๐ ๏ธ Channel Filter Fix:
Channels filter now works as expected to ensure proper channel visibility.
๐ ๏ธ Expired Guest Cleanup:
Fixed removal of expired shared channel guest/member requests to ensure expired identities are cleaned up.
๐ ๏ธ Expirable Group Removal:
Expirable groups are now correctly removed during workspace soft archive operations.
๐ ๏ธ Hard Archive Process Error:
Addressed hard archive request failure caused by service account attempting to change members and owners, preventing request rejections.
๐ ๏ธ Group User Sync Correction
Corrected group user removal from Teams when removed from workspace to maintain sync consistency.
๐ ๏ธ Template Management Restoration
Restored manageability of templates after upgrading from v2.24.x or v2.25.x to v2.26 to prevent locked templates.
๐ ๏ธ Add Groups Option Lock Fix
Fixed inability to change the โAllow to add groupsโ option in Site Template release mode.
๐ ๏ธ Soft Archive Removal Fix
Fixed removal of group users during workspace soft archive to maintain security cleanup.
๐ ๏ธ Non-Expirable User Protection
Prevented removal of non-expirable users during workspace soft archive operations.
๐ ๏ธ Governance Error Visibility
Members governance errors are now visible during workspace creation to improve user feedback.
------------------------------------------------------------
Release v2.26.0
(25.02.2025)
Introduction
This release delivers one of our largest updates ever, packing new features, key improvements, and bug fixes to expand groups support, tighten governance, modernize the UI, and boost performance across the platform.
๐ Comprehensive Groups Support:
Added end-to-end Azure AD Group provisioning and lifecycle management in workspaces and channelsโincluding bulk updates, expiration policies, and visibility of group users in request details
๐ Advanced Role Management:
Introduced dedicated views and editing capabilities for Owner, Member, and Guest roles at both the workspace and channel levels.
๐ Governance & API Enhancements:
Added new filter parameters to APIs for custom request views, surfaced governance errors as a message bar, and enabled refresh-token support for more reliable backend calls.
๐ UI Consolidation & Navigation:
Unified context menus in card and list views, displayed workspace titles in channel request pop-ups, and improved tooltips around guest-management logic.
๐ ๏ธ Optimize Inactivity Job:
Reduced processing time and resource use for lifecycle-expiration tasks.
๐ ๏ธ Validation Improvements:
Enforced strict workspace title, URL, and mail-naming rules during creation flows to prevent invalid inputs.
๐ ๏ธ Solutions Loading & Template Editor Upgrades:
Accelerated solution-list loading and updated npm dependencies for a smoother template-editing experience.
๐ ๏ธ UI Framework Modernization:
Upgraded front-end to the latest SPFx framework.
๐ ๏ธ Tooltip & Info Enhancements:
Clarified channel and workspace settings with optimized tooltips and contextual help in pop-ups.
๐ ๏ธ Ensuring greater stability and reliability:
In addition to the above, this release resolves bug fixes addressing everything from API permission errors to archiving-UI inconsistencies, ensuring greater stability and reliability across all provisioning scenarios.
------------------------------------------------------------
Release v2.25.3
(01.04.2025)
Introduction
This patch release resolves a Graph API permission error that prevented retrieval of OneNote notebooks in Teams when using app-only permissions, restoring seamless notebook access.
๐ ๏ธ OneNote Notebooks Retrieval:
Resolved an issue where team OneNote notebooks could not be fetched via Graph with app-only permissions.
------------------------------------------------------------
Release v2.25.2
(17.03.2025)
Introduction
This patch release addresses several critical issues related to shared channel membership, archiving settings fallback, channel filtering, request handling in trial environments, approval logic response types, and expiration cleanup for shared channel guests.
๐ ๏ธ Shared Channel Guest Removal Failure:
Fixed an issue where shared channel guests were not removed due to missing removal requests.
๐ ๏ธ Archiving Fallback Value Handling:
Corrected behavior so that workspaces without SharePoint archiving settings now use the template-defined โfallbackโ value after a bulk update.
๐ ๏ธ Channel Filter Malfunction:
Resolved an issue where channel filters did not work as expected, restoring correct filtering behavior.
๐ ๏ธ Approval Response Type Correction:
Fixed the incorrect request response type in approvals to ensure proper approval flow.
๐ ๏ธ Expired Guest Cleanup:
Resolved a failure in removing expired shared channel guest/member requests to ensure expired users are cleaned up.
------------------------------------------------------------
Release v2.25.1
(26.02.2025)
Introduction
This maintenance release delivers targeted lifecycle improvements to strengthen expiration policies and corrects an issue in archive-date computation following workspace migrations. These fixes help ensure that workspaces are cleaned up reliably and on schedule.
๐ ๏ธ Lifecycle Fix Backport:
Brought key lifecycle fixes into the v2.25 branch to ensure consistent handling of member and guest expirations across all channels and workspaces.
๐ ๏ธ Archive Date Correction:
Resolved an issue where the archive date was calculated incorrectly after migrating a workspace, preventing premature or delayed archive actions.
------------------------------------------------------------
Release v2.25.0
(31.01.2025)
Introduction
This release introduces significant enhancements in security and user lifecycle management. With the advanced security enhancements and improvements in external user management, organizations can better control access to their collaboration spaces. Additionally, we have addressed several performance and stability issues to improve the overall user experience.
๐ Security Enhancements for Platform Management:
We have strengthened the security framework for workspace provisioning and management by introducing additional authentication safeguards. These enhancements align with best practices to further protect platform operations.
๐ User Expiration in Shared Channels:
We have introduced automated expiration policies for all members of shared channels. If the channel owner does not extend the expiration date, both internal and external users will be automatically removed after a defined period. This helps organizations enforce access policies more effectively and maintain a secure collaboration environment.
Enhancements
- Improved handling of newly invited guests to ensure timely availability in private channels.
- Resolved inconsistencies in user removal processes when approval workflows are in place.
- Optimized system behavior when dealing with orphaned workspaces and inactive owners.
- Enhanced lifecycle notification reliability to ensure timely updates.
- Lifecycle management improvements for workspaces with large document volumes.
- Resolved an issue preventing admins from archiving or deleting workspaces via the Admin Portal.
- Various stability and performance improvements for channel operations.
- Solution Key Vault Assemblies have been updated to the latest version.
- Teams Groups without a General tab can now be migrated.
- Wording optimizations in the Admin Portal for creating new template versions.
- Stabilization of auto-approval rejection to improve workflow consistency.
Thank you for using Valprovia! Stay tuned for more updates in the future. ๐